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ound bacon, diced
- 1 large onion, finely chopped
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 1/4 cup maple syrup
- 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
- 1/4 cup bourbon
- 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Cook the bacon: Heat a large skillet over medium heat and add the diced bacon. Cook until crispy, then remove the bacon with a slotted spoon, leaving about 2 tablespoons of bacon fat in the pan.
- Sauté the onion: Add the finely chopped onion to the skillet and cook until softened and translucent, about 5 minutes.
- Add garlic: Stir in the min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.
- Create the sauce: Pour in the brown sugar, maple syrup, balsamic vinegar, and bourbon. Stir to combine, then bring the mixture to a simmer.
- Combine and season: Return the cooked bacon to the skillet and mix it into the sauce. Add smoked paprika and cayenne pepper, then season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Simmer and thicken: Reduce the heat to low and let the mixture simmer for 30-40 minutes, stirring occasionally, until it thickens and reaches a jam-like consistency.
- Cool and store: Once the jam has thickened, remove it from the heat and let it cool slightly. Transfer to a jar or airtight container and store in the refrigerator.

Notes
- Make ahead: This bacon jam tastes even better the next day as the flavors meld together, so feel free to prepare it in advance.
- Storage: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to two weeks. It can also be frozen for up to three months.
- Variations: Substitute bourbon with whiskey or strong brewed coffee for a different flavor profile. Adjust the cayenne pepper to your preferred spice level.
